 Description   

The TenantMigrationAccessBlocker can enter the committed or aborted states (kReject and kAborted, respectively) through a write unit of work onCommit handler or the op observer onMajorityCommitPointUpdate() listener. If these are interleaved, the access blocker may try to enter the same state twice, which triggers an invariant. Instead the methods for entering either state should early return if that state has already been entered.
